Biography
Keivin Isufaj is a Software Engineer whose work spans trajectory data analysis, bioinformatics, and computer vision, including projects on oral lesion detection and segmentation, 3D object detection, and depth estimation. He contributed to the Fanar project, focusing on developing image generation models that are culturally aligned and aware. His current research explores optimization techniques for faster inference and smaller memory footprints in deep learning and generative models.
